Position Summary
This role serves as a high-level technical resource supporting manufacturing operations through advanced troubleshooting, repair, and optimization of electronic, control, and instrumentation systems. The Electronics Analyst works closely with maintenance, engineering, and production teams to minimize downtime, ensure safe operation, and improve equipment reliability.
The Senior Electronics Analyst role reflects the same responsibilities, with greater depth of experience, broader technical mastery, and the ability to independently lead complex diagnostics and improvements.
Key Responsibilities
- Troubleshoot, diagnose, and repair complex electronic and control system issues beyond the scope of standard electrician work
- Program, maintain, troubleshoot, and optimize PLC systems using PC-based and manufacturer-specific software
- Support new equipment installations by identifying and correcting control logic or system integration issues
- Install, calibrate, maintain, and repair industrial instrumentation and control devices, including sensors, transmitters, converters, and actuators
- Troubleshoot and maintain variable-speed AC/DC drives and associated feedback and control systems
- Maintain and calibrate electronic scales, weighing, and ingredient systems, ensuring accurate documentation and compliance
- Install and support precision measurement systems and related control equipment
- Partner with engineering and vendors on equipment upgrades, commissioning, and continuous improvement initiatives
- Provide technical guidance and support to electricians and maintenance personnel as needed
Qualifications
- Degree in Industrial Electronics Technology or equivalent combination of education and experience
- Strong knowledge of industrial electronics, PLCs, instrumentation, drives, and control systems
- Proficiency with diagnostic and test equipment such as multimeters, oscilloscopes, recorders, and insulation testers
- Solid computer skills, including technical documentation and reporting
- Ability to work independently while also collaborating effectively in a team environment
